The New Orleans Office of Homeland Security & Emergency Preparedness continues to monitor all tropical weather in the Gulf and Atlantic. While there are NO tropical watches, warnings, or advisories currently in effect for the local area, now is the time to review your hurricane preparedness plans.
Showers and thunderstorms are showing signs of organization in association with a broad area of low pressure located over the central Gulf of Mexico.
Environmental conditions appear conducive for development of this system, and a tropical depression or tropical storm is likely to form before it reaches the western Gulf of Mexico coastline on Tuesday.
Interests in southern Texas and northern Mexico should monitor the progress of this system as tropical storm watches or warnings are likely to be issued later today.
Formation chance through 48 hours: High, 80%.
Formation chance through 7 days: High, 80%.
